Merrill Hires In FX Sales And Expands Local Markets FX

PEOPLE NEWS

LONDON -- US investment bank Merrill Lynch in London has hired two in senior FX sales, and several emerging markets dealers to expand the local markets group.

Graham Edwards, head of European FX sales in London, told FX Week the hires are part of a long-term process of expanding Merrill Lynch's FX presence in "potential growth areas". He said the bank was able to take advantage of one recent banking-merger to hire new dealers.
